Fast and slow electromagnetic waves in a longitudinally magnetized thin-film ferromagnetic metamaterial

M. D. Amel'chenko, S. V. Grishin, Yu. P. Sharaevsky

Saratov State University
Full-text PDF (268 kB) Citations (5)
Abstract: The results of a theoretical study of the electrodynamic characteristics of fast and slow electromagnetic waves (EMWs) propagating in a metamaterial are presented. The metamaterial consists of a ferromagnetic film inside which a periodic lattice of thin metal wires is located. It has been established that the ferromagnetic thin-film metamaterial possesses the properties of a left-handed medium at frequencies of slow electromagnetic waves. It is shown that, in a ferromagnetic metamaterial, compared with a conventional ferromagnetic film, the cutoff frequencies of fast and slow EMWs shift to a higher frequency range, and EMWs themselves become strongly slowed waves.
